The mainstream companies are jumping to the bandwagon of crypto. As per the reports, Apple Pay users can now also spend bitcoins using the native app.
As per the report, it is claiming that bitcoins and various other popular cryptocurrencies can now be used for payment through the Apple Pay app. An app called BitPay also allows users to buy bitcoins and utilize the prepaid MasterCard of Apple Pay. The BitPay wallet can now be added to both Apple Pay and Apple Wallet.
The BitPay wallet app is also going to work with other cryptocurrencies like Ether, Bitcoin Cash, and with USD coin, Paxos Standard, and Binance USD, which are working as dollar-pegged stable coins.
As per the description of the application on Google Play Store, any of the users can apply for BitPay Card to begin spending on crypto instantly. It is claiming for approval, which is taking seconds, and the virtual card is going to be available for immediate online usage. The users are also going to get a physical card, which after few weeks, enables users to convert their crypto in cash at ATMs or to spend at any of the retail stores. It is, however, only going to be available in the United States.
The BitPay app is also anticipated to roll-out support on prominent payment applications like Google Pay and Samsung Pay. It is going to allow a large number of Android users to gain access to the service of the app.
